Recently, the NBA came out with the players for the Rising Stars game for this season, and Evan Mobley of the Cleveland Cavaliers made it on the team. The Cavaliers big man has impressed many with his dominating play style, including NBA legend, Dwyane Wade. While on NBA on TNT, Wade compared the Cavaliers rookie to one of his former teammates.

Flash said Evan Mobley reminds him a lot of his Miami Heat teammate, Chris Bosh.

Mobley is the current front-runner to win ROTY. His ability for his huge frame is extraordinary. He can shoot the ball well while also dominating on the inside. Moreover, he plays on both ends of the floor. Mobley is a big reason the Cavaliers have elevated up to the fourth seed in the NBA. Likewise, he was elected into the Rising Stars game.

Dwyane Wade sees Chris Bosh in Cavaliers’ Mobley

While on NBA on TNT, the crew were discussing Mobley being in the Rising Stars game. This is when Wade had some high praise for him. He started off by saying how he doesn’t know the young stars in the league. But Mobley caught his eye right away. The Flash then said Mobley resonates a right-handed Chris Bosh on the court.

He said, “I don’t know a lot of the young guys. So he is one of the guys who stood out to me because when I look at Evan Mobley, I see Chris Bosh. I see Toronto Raptors Chris Bosh, but a right hand. Just the way he plays the game, the way he can take you inside and outside.” Wade continued singing praises and said, “Man, it is good to see this kid be a part of helping this team win. He’s not just there to fill up the stat sheet.”

Mobley is a modern-day big man and is playing his part for Cleveland. He is putting up 14.8 points, 8.1 rebounds, 2.6 assists, and 1.7 blocks per game in his rookie season. Like Bosh, Mobley can shoot the ball and also attack the rim with ease. His size and production all point towards a young Chris Bosh who made a serious impact on the Raptors in his early years.

Mobley has helped elevate the offense on the Cavaliers. Moreover, because of his ability to play inside, the Cavaliers rely a lot on their seven-footers. With 3 bigs in their lineup, Darius Garland does a perfect job in utilizing all of them, and the three big men play a huge role in slowing down the smaller guards on the defensive end.
